§ 36-332 — Commissioner examinations and investigations.
Oklahoma·Title 36 Insurance
A.The Insurance Commissioner may conduct such examinations and investigations of matters, within the scope of the authority of the Commissioner, as the Commissioner may deem proper to secure information useful in the lawful administration of the applicable provisions of the Oklahoma Insurance Code and other statutes for which the Commissioner has jurisdiction.
